
In a horrific incident that has sparked outrage across Tamil Nadu, a three-year-old child of migrant workers was allegedly gang-raped and abandoned in a thorny thicket in the SIPCOT industrial area of Gummidipoondi. The child succumbed to her injuries today, police said.
As reported in Daily Thanthi, the area is home to over 300 factories, employing thousands of workers from Bihar, Uttar Pradesh, Odisha, and Jharkhand, who live in rented accommodations with their families.
According to police, the child went missing yesterday evening from the SIPCOT area. Her parents, along with members of the public, launched a frantic search and were shocked to find her lying injured in a thorny thicket. The child was immediately rescued and taken to Gummidipoondi Government Hospital. After receiving first aid, she was referred to Stanley Government Hospital in Chennai for advanced treatment. However, despite intensive medical care, she died today.
Preliminary investigations revealed that four migrant workers allegedly gang-raped the three-year-old and dumped her in the bushes. Police have arrested one of the accused, identified as Manji (19), a native of Bihar. He is being interrogated, while a manhunt has been launched for the three other suspects.
Meanwhile, local residents and members of the public staged protests demanding the immediate arrest of all perpetrators. The brutal nature of the crime has sent shockwaves through the region, with widespread condemnation pouring in from across Tamil Nadu.
After the news of the crime spread like wildfire, the police issued a clarification that the child was not gangraped as reported.
